Chris Akayan

Chief Culture & Capability Officer

BEc (Hons)

Chris Akayan was appointed Chief Culture & Capability Officer in March 2017. He is responsible for Human Resources, Sustainability and HSE. Chris joined Mirvac in August 2014 as Group General Manager, Human Resources.

Chris has over 20 years' experience in the property sector with deep expertise across human resources, leadership, innovation, health and safety, sustainability, organisational development, succession planning, learning and development, diversity and employee engagement.

Prior to joining Mirvac, Chris spent nearly 10 years at Stockland, with two years in London as Head of HR and Corporate Affairs in Stockland’s UK business. Chris has also held senior consulting positions with Capgemini and EY leading projects with a focus on human resources, organisational design, change management and leadership development.  Chris commenced his career as an economist with the Federal government.

Chris holds a Bachelor of Economics (Hons) from the University of Sydney.
